Output 6ab98872669c1bcecbfbd173ad079e09fcfb96003ea202ab1a4ddf8cd2a7c9ea:0

value
40927
script pubkey
OP_0 OP_PUSHBYTES_20 30ee10787970b864a5c37aadb9188689a4fc2408
address
bc1qxrhpq7rewzuxffwr02kmjxyx3xj0cfqgr0xnfc
transaction
6ab98872669c1bcecbfbd173ad079e09fcfb96003ea202ab1a4ddf8cd2a7c9ea
confirmations
426523
spent
true